GCC inclou suport per al llenguatge de programació Modula-2

La part principal de GCC inclou la interfície m2 i la biblioteca libgm2, que us permeten utilitzar les eines estàndard de GCC per crear programes en el llenguatge de programació Modula-2. S'admet el muntatge de codi corresponent als dialectes PIM2, PIM3 i PIM4, així com l'estàndard ISO acceptat per a un idioma determinat. Els canvis s'inclouen a la branca GCC 13, que s'espera que es publiqui el maig de 2023.

Modula-2 va ser desenvolupat l'any 1978 per Niklaus Wirth, continua el desenvolupament del llenguatge Pascal i es posiciona com un llenguatge de programació per a sistemes industrials altament fiables (per exemple, utilitzat en programari per a satèl·lits GLONASS). Modula-2 és el predecessor de llenguatges com Modula-3, Oberon i Zonnon. A més de Modula-2, GCC inclou interfícies per als llenguatges C, C++, Objective-C, Fortran, Go, D, Ada i Rust. Entre les interfícies no acceptades a la composició principal de GCC hi ha Modula-3, GNU Pascal, Mercury, Cobol, VHDL i PL/1.

Font: opennet.ru

Afegeix comentari